The 2.6 Challenge has been created with the aim of replacing funding that charities will lose due to the cancellation of the London marathon, which would have taken place on Sunday 26th April. Last year, the marathon raised nearly £67 million for UK charities.


The Somerville Foundation is particularly important to us because the founder was the consultant who looked and cared for my dad through some of  his illness.. 

The Somerville Foundation has been supporting adults and young people born with a heart condition for 26 years. With almost all charity fundraising events being cancelled, we need to raise funds to ensure we can continue to support congenital heart patients well into the future.

About the charity

Somerville Heart Foundation

Verified by JustGiving

RCN 1138088
Somerville Heart Foundation helps young people and adults who were born with a heart condition. We provide information and advice services plus conferences and events to educate, raise awareness and combat isolation. We also support mental health with counselling and workshops.
